    • The IT security incident is defined as an event that involves a security breach, such as hacking, intrusion or denial of service attack on a critical system, or on a system which compromises the security, integrity or confidentiality of any customer information. 15 Reporting Critical System

    • A financial penalty of $120,000 was imposed on Secur Solutions Group for failing to put in place reasonable security arrangements to protect a database containing the personal data of blood donors from being publicly accessible online. Click here to find out more.
